1. Large-scale invasions of riparian trees can alter the quantity and quality of allochthonous inputs of leaf litter to streams and thus have the potential to alter stream organic matter dynamics. Non-native saltcedar (Tamarix sp.) and Russian olive (Elaeagnus angustifolia) are now among the most common trees in riparian zones in western North America, yet their impacts on energy flow in stream...

Benincasa hispida Cogn. (Cucurbitaceae) commonly known as wax gourd (1) is an important ingredient of kushmanda lehyam, an Ayurvedic medicine widely used as rejuvenative agent (Rasayana) in treatment of epilepsy and other nervous disorders (2). In Ayurvedic system of medicine, Benincasa hispida fruits are used for treatment of schizophrenia and other psychologic disorders (3). Methanolic extrac...

Hydrologic alterations of river systems in western North America over the past century have increased soil salinity, contributing to the establishment and spread of an introduced halophytic species, Tamarix ramosissima (Ledeb.). The physiological responses of Tamarix ramosissima to salinity stress are incompletely known. To assess the salinity tolerance of this species, we measured several whol...

Tamarix ramosissima is a naturalized, nonnative plant species which has become widespread along riparian corridors throughout the western United States. We test the hypothesis that the distribution and success of Tamarix result from human modification of river-flow regimes. We conducted a natural experiment in eight ecoregions in arid and semiarid portions of the western United States, measurin...
